Knowing Peach State's Filing Deadline Limitations


Understanding Georgia's statute of limitations for personal injury claims is essential. In Georgia, you generally have 24 months from the date of the injury event to file a lawsuit. Missing this deadline means losing your right to pursue compensation. Some exceptions apply—especially in cases involving delayed injury discovery. How Long Do I Have to File a Commercial Vehicle Collision Injury Claim in Georgia?


The legal filing deadline for personal injury claim Georgia is generally two years from the injury occurrence. Overlooking this window could block you from obtaining recovery entirely.
